What is the molarity of the solution obtained by mixing 50 mL of concentrated H2SO4 (18 M) with 50 mL of water (assume volumes are additive)?

  1. 36 M
  2. 18 M
  3. 9 M
  4. 6 M

Correct answer: 9 M

Solution

Moles of H2SO4 stay constant while the volume doubles, so the molarity halves from 18 M to 9 M.
